HELSINKI - Police in Finland have arrested a 24-year-old Iraqi man on suspicion of murder and war crimes related to the massacre of hundreds of Iraqi soldiers by the Islamic State group in 2014.

The Finnish National Bureau of Investigation says the suspected crimes were committed at Camp Speicher, a former U.S. base just outside Tikrit in northern Iraq. The agency said Wednesday that the suspect, who was not identified, arrived in Finland in the fall of 2015. It gave no further details.

An agency statement said it was also investigating the involvement of two brothers who are suspected of "terrorist murders" in the same massacre.

Iraq on Sunday executed 36 men convicted of taking part in the 2014 killings that took place after IS militants captured 1,700 Iraqi army soldiers.
